Where is the official Discord login page?

Open {site} and select Login. Check that the page clearly identifies Discord before entering account details, especially if you reached it through search results.

A copied page can look like the Discord login page while sending your credentials to someone else. These checks reduce that risk:

  • Type Discord’s name into your browser or use a saved bookmark that you created after visiting the official site.
  • Avoid login links in unsolicited emails, direct messages, advertisements, or messages claiming that your account will be closed immediately.
  • Use the official Discord app when possible. Get the app through the app store built into your phone or through Discord’s own site.
  • If the page asks for unusual information, close it and start again from Discord’s official site or app.

How do I log in to Discord?

Have the email address or phone number associated with your Discord account, your password, and any verification method enabled on the account ready before starting.

  1. Open the official Discord login page or Discord app.
  2. Enter the email address or phone number connected to the account.
  3. Enter the Discord password. Passwords are case-sensitive, so check capitalization.
  4. Select Log In.
  5. Complete any email or security verification that Discord requests.

The desktop login screen may also display a QR code. A QR code is a square image that the signed-in Discord mobile app can scan to approve a desktop login. Scan only a QR code displayed on the official Discord app or login page, review the approval prompt carefully, and do not scan a code sent by another person.

If you are trying to login to a Discord account with more than one possible email address, use the address that receives Discord account messages. Creating another account will not restore access to the original account.

How do I sign in to Discord on mobile or desktop?

In the official mobile app, the Discord sign-in option appears when the app opens without an active account. Choose Log In rather than Register, then enter the account credentials and complete any requested verification.

In the desktop app, the account login Discord screen appears when no account is signed in. You can enter your credentials or use the QR option shown on that screen. QR login requires access to a Discord mobile app that is already signed in to the account.

If Discord opens directly to another account, use Discord’s account controls to log out or switch accounts before attempting a different Discord account sign in. On a shared device, do not save the password, and sign out when finished.

What should I do if I forgot my Discord password?

Use the Forgot your password option on the Discord sign-in screen. Discord sends the recovery message to the email address associated with the account, so you must be able to open that inbox.

  1. Enter the account’s email address on the Discord login screen.
  2. Select Forgot your password.
  3. Open the password-reset message sent by Discord.
  4. Follow the instructions in that message to choose a new, unique password.
  5. Return to the official Discord sign-in screen and try the new password.

If the message does not arrive, check the spam, junk, promotions, and filtered folders. Search the inbox for messages from Discord, confirm that the entered email address has no typing errors, and wait briefly before making another request.

If you cannot access the associated email inbox, contact the email provider about restoring that inbox. Discord support may ask for account details, but you should never send anyone your password, multifactor authentication code, or backup code.

Why can’t I sign in to Discord?

A failed Discord account login can result from incorrect credentials, an unfinished verification request, an account restriction, or a connection problem. Read the exact message on the login screen before changing account settings.

  • Incorrect credentials: Re-enter the email address or phone number and password manually. Check capitalization, keyboard language, spaces added by autofill, and recently changed passwords.
  • Verification request: Check the associated email inbox or use the security method requested on screen. Multifactor authentication means that Discord requires an additional approved security method after the password.
  • Code never arrives: Check filtered email folders and confirm that the requested destination belongs to the account. Do not repeatedly request codes in rapid succession.
  • Disabled or suspended account: Follow the instructions in Discord’s notice. Use official support if the notice provides an appeal or review option; do not create workarounds to bypass the restriction.
  • Connection problem: Confirm that other sites or apps load, switch between Wi-Fi and cellular data if available, and restart Discord. Check Discord’s official status information for a reported outage.
  • App problem: Close and reopen Discord, install available updates from the official app store, or try the official browser login page.

Do not disable security protections simply to make the login work. If a browser extension, VPN, or network filter appears to interfere, test carefully on a trusted connection and restore your normal security settings afterward.

How do I contact Discord support about account access?

Use Discord’s official support area and choose the category that best matches login, hacked-account, disabled-account, or email-access trouble. Submit one clear request and keep any confirmation message so you can refer to the same case.

Provide the email address associated with the account, the Discord username if known, the exact error message, the device and app or browser used, and the steps already tried. Screenshots can help, but remove unrelated personal information before attaching them.

Discord support does not need your password, authentication code, backup code, or a QR login approval. If anyone asks for those secrets, stop communicating and return to Discord’s official support area.
